  • @UAHawaii lol just noticed this vid gets a little boring but yeah, really good headset. Also hard wearing, dropped mine on the apron a few times turing pre flight but still as good as new. They are a little bulcky though and after may be 3 hours not stop wearing you need a little 5 min break. not terrbily expensive and works well. I think if I was going to by a new headset and had the money I'd get the light speed zulu 2. Looks slightly better.
